It is autumn now, the air becomes dry, and the temperature gradually gets colder. People with allergic rhinitis will have their noses become more sensitive. Even people who do not have allergic rhinitis should help prevent it, otherwise once you get it, it will not be so easy to get rid of it. How to prevent allergic rhinitis in autumnFirst of all, stay away from allergens, keep the room ventilated, dry, and clean in time. Bedding should be changed and washed frequently, and places where dust mites are likely to live, such as sofas, carpets, curtains, etc., should be cleaned in time. If the weather turns cooler, you can wear a mask when going out to avoid being stimulated by cold wind. If smog is prevalent, you should go out less frequently and wear an anti-smog mask when going out. Avoid strenuous exercise. Don't smoke and avoid exposure to secondhand smoke. Pay attention to your diet and avoid foods that are prone to allergies, such as seafood, alcohol, etc. If you have rhinitis every autumn, you should use control drugs in advance, such as montelukast sodium, instead of waiting until the rhinitis attacks. Controlling in advance is more beneficial to the immune system. Waiting until the attack to use drugs will make the condition more likely to escalate. If the environment is suitable, you can exercise moderately to enhance your immunity. However, do not exercise in an environment with many allergens, and do not exercise vigorously, as both of these situations can easily aggravate the condition. Is allergic rhinitis related to heredity?Allergic rhinitis has a certain relationship with heredity. If parents have allergic rhinitis or the previous generation has rhinitis, then the next generation will have a genetic tendency. Patients with allergic rhinitis usually have bronchial asthma, and their brothers and sisters also have allergic rhinitis, bronchitis, etc. When the weather alternates between cold and hot, it usually manifests as chest tightness, cough, sputum, and difficulty in tolerating certain odors. Allergic rhinitis is a series of symptoms caused by contact with allergens, such as nasal congestion, runny nose, sneezing, dizziness, memory loss, etc. Because people with allergic rhinitis are not all the same in their sensitivity to allergens. Some are allergic to cold air, some are allergic to pollen, and some are allergic to mites. So rhinitis is not absolutely 100% hereditary. What are the main allergens of allergic rhinitis?1. Inhalation allergens: dust, dust mites, feathers, cotton wool, animal fur, etc.; 2. Food allergens: fish, shrimp, eggs, milk, flour, peanuts, soybeans, etc.; 3. Contact allergens: cosmetics, gasoline, paint, alcohol, etc. If you are allergic to pollen, wear a mask when going out during the flowering season, especially in spring, and try to go out less. If you are allergic to animal fur, avoid contact with furry animals. Rinse your nasal cavity with saline 1-2 times a day to wash out allergens and nasal secretions, keep your nasal cavity moist, and improve the function of nasal mucosal cells. |
